Summary of Responsibilities

This Spawn Point Work Study Position consists of CCAC Lion’s Den facility management on nights and weekends. Employees will manage the passive programing schedules of the CCAC consisting of but not limited to watch parties, equipment checkout, inventory and maintenance reports, attendance and usage reports, running gaming tournaments, and Multi-Media Room assistance.
